New Delhi: India and the United States on Tuesday signed a Rs 32,000-crore deal for tri-service procurement of 31 MQ-9B Sky/Sea Guardian High Altitude Long Endurance (HALE) Remote Pilot Aircraft System (RPAS). The agreement, which also includes setting up a Maintenance, Repair, and Overhaul (MRO) facility here, has been finalized under a government-to-government framework. It aims […]
